Of course there is noise reduction. CMOS is basically noisier than CCD. 
The advantage of CMOS, as I understand it, is that allows noise 
reduction at the sensor level. That seems to allow better control of 
noise with reduced side effects. I think Canon opts for a bit more of 
it for their trademark silky images. Both Kodak and Nikon have drawn 
the noise reduction line a bit differently in their CMOS cameras. 
Basically, though, any CMOS chip is going to have some basic noise 
reduction to equal or better the intrinsic noise level of a CCD.
